MATLAB生产服务器

集成MATLAB算法集成到网络,数据库和企业应用程序

MATLAB Production Server™允许您将自定义分析集成到运行在专用服务器或云中的web、数据库和生产企业应用程序中。你可以在MATLAB中创建算法®使用MATLAB编译SDK™它们打包,然后将它们部署到MATLAB生产服务器而无需重新编写或创建自定义的基础设施。然后,用户可以自动访问最新版本的分析的。

MATLAB生产服务器同时管理多个MATLAB运行时版本。其结果是,在不同版本的MATLAB开发的算法可以纳入你的应用程序。在多处理器和多核计算机服务器运行,提供并发工作请求的低延迟处理。您可以部署规模容量上额外的计算节点服务器和提供冗余。

入门:

MATLAB分析的生产部署

由领域专家建立直接投入生产的IT系统没有在不同的语言重新编写部署分析算法。部署的分析可以纳入各种各样的大型观众访问企业应用程序。

领域专家

使用后MATLAB为了开发、测试和改进它们的算法,领域专家使用MATLAB Compiler SDK来打包最终的MATLAB分析,以便在没有IT团队帮助的情况下部署到MATLAB产品服务器上。

开发和包装算法或模型。

IT应用开发

IT应用开发者部署MATLAB分析集成到使用附带的轻量级客户端库的企业应用程序。

创建调用部署MATLAB程序中的功能的企业应用程序。

IT系统管理员

IT系统管理员管理中的MATLAB生产服务器的操作企业IT生态系统。MATLAB产品服务器自动处理多个MATLAB算法/分析的执行,即使它们需要不同的MATLAB运行时版本。

管理MATLAB分析的部署。

缩放内部部署还是在云中

MATLAB生产服务器扩展处理通过无状态架构多个同时请求。

垂直缩放

处理器内核和存储器添加到一个服务器计算机来服务更多的请求或减少响应时间。计算密集型请求可以被委托为处理MATLAB并行服务器集群™。

通过向服务器添加处理器来扩展。

水平翻转

添加服务器机的群集内处理更多的工作负载。客户端请求可以使用第三方的负载均衡软件或设备,可以针对任何MATLAB生产Server实例的集群。这种做法不仅提高了性能,还采用了弹性和高度可用的系统架构。

通过增加服务器负载平衡器之后缩放。

规模的云

使用云来扩展您的服务器实例。MathWorks公司提供的参考架构,提供全面配置MATLAB生产服务器部署在云平台,如亚马逊®Web服务和微软®天蓝®

MATLAB生产服务器云控制台。

安全和加密

MATLAB生产服务器采用业界标准的加密,认证和访问控制协议来保护您的MATLAB算法和数据的保密性。

加密

请以MATLAB生产服务器可以使用TLS / SSL协议进行加密。磁盘上的MATLAB代码也被加密,以确保您的知识产权。

加密在运输途中和在休息。

认证

用户可以使用基于令牌或基于证书的认证方法来认证用户访问MATLAB生产服务器。

个人身份验证访问MATLAB生产服务器的身份。

访问控制

使用身份验证MATLAB的生产服务器的访问。随着基于证书的身份认证,访问是基于客户端证书中的用户名授予。随着基于令牌的认证,访问基于在相关目录组成员授予。

安全管理对受保护资源的访问。

客户端应用程序访问

发布到MATLAB生产服务器MATLAB的分析可以从用多种编程语言的,或通过一个RESTful API的应用程序进行访问。

企业应用程序

轻量级客户端库让你在打电话从台式机,服务器或数据库应用程序部署到MATLAB生产服务器MATLAB分析功能的开发语言,如C#,Java的®,C / C ++,或Python®

网络和移动应用

访问部署的MATLAB分析的Web和移动应用程序通常通过使用JSON有效负载输入和输出的RESTful API调用函数。服务发现API允许这些应用程序确定可用的功能以及所需的输入和输出参数。

金融Web应用程序访问部署到MATLAB生产服务器MATLAB分析。

第三方可视化应用程序

从可视化部署MATLAB的分析结果中你最喜欢的可视化应用等的Tableau®,Spotfire中®,Qlik®和Power BI®

表图的参考架构。

数据集成

包括从关系数据库,NoSQL数据库和消息传递引擎数据到您的部署MATLAB分析。

数据库

MATLAB生产服务器附带的Redis,高速内存数据库的函数调用之间存储状态。键值界面,您可以轻松地从MATLAB代码读取和写入数据的Redis。您还可以读取和写入数据到各种数据源的支持万博1manbetx数据库工具箱™

读取数据和写入数据到各种数据库。

流和消息传递引擎

摄取使用连接器,流媒体和消息传递引擎如天青物联网中心,天青事件集线器,或Apache卡夫卡的传感器和设备到您的MATLAB分析遥测。

集成流数据。

操作数据

从业务系统如OSIsoft的流资产数据和时间序列数据®PI系统™资产框架来分析MATLAB。然后,部署分析可以将数据处理到标志异常,建议预防性维护,或预测资产在剩余使用寿命。

集成了OSIsoft PI系统资产框架。

管理和监控

MATLAB生产服务器可以从一个基于Web的管理控制台或操作系统的命令行进行管理。命令行接口支持脚本自动化。万博1manbetx

管理

管理服务器实例,应用程序和服务器设置从易于浏览的Web管理控制台。

MATLAB生产服务器仪表板。

监控

实时检查关键系统指标,如CPU利用率、内存利用率和吞吐量,以评估系统的健康状况,并采取先发制人的措施来改进响应时间或避免瓶颈。

监控关键的系统指标。

最新功能

Python客户端

万博1manbetx支持为Python 3.6和Python 3.7

Java客户端

万博1manbetx为的Protobuf序列化支持

MATLAB数据类型的JSON表示

万博1manbetx对于字符串数组,枚举和日期时间阵列支持

看到发布说明对任何这些特征和对应的功能的详细说明。